Toney available for Peterborough’s clash with Portsmouth
Posted Thursday, March 05, 2020 by PA
Ivan Toney is available for selection this weekend when Peterborough host fellow promotion hopefuls Portsmouth in Sky Bet League One.
Toney, the club’s top goal scorer returns from suspension and will look to lead Peterborough to the Championship where they have not played since the 2012-2013 season.
Frankie Kent is out with a knee problem and is targeting the Bolton game for a return.
The rest of the Posh’s squad is fit and available for selection.
Portsmouth do not have any injury worries when they travel to London Road on Saturday.
Their squad was left unscathed after their FA Cup exit at the hands of Arsenal but will be without Christian Burgess. He received a yellow card against Rochdale meaning he reached 10 bookings and will miss this promotion clash.
Bryn Morris remains a long-term absentee, he is continuing to slowly regain fitness from a groin injury.
Pompey are firmly in the promotion hunt and currently sit only three points off the automatic promotion places.
